Conference themes

This highly acclaimed course focuses on a wide array of interesting and practical topics presented by noted authorities.

Program Objectives

  • Identify prevention and treatment of altitude illness based on an understanding of the underlying physiology
  • Recognize and properly manage frostbite in the field
  • Identify and treat hypothermia in the field
  • Identify fracture and dislocation in the wilderness
  • Identify the pathophysiology and treatment of heat-related illness
